top of page

POP! Television Stranger Things Demogorgon #428
UPC: 889698133272

POP! Television Stranger Things Demogorgon #428

SKU: OKIMONO428D
AED118.00Price
Quantity
Only 1 left in stock

    You Might Also Like

    bottom of page